Output 085d0614367698c34c2ba226c3597c0eeef88f5e76ea125b12fa3a6baf3366d2:3
- value
- 65664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71440fc39cb48527a35dbdd2293df9839722e99a OP_EQUAL
- address
- 3C1upDpyUYn3jg75XHUb2Kff53tzpfuH6V
- transaction
- 085d0614367698c34c2ba226c3597c0eeef88f5e76ea125b12fa3a6baf3366d2
- confirmations
- 204907
- spent
- true